400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么excel算数会有偏差

作者:路由通
|
47人看过
发布时间:2025-09-26 13:35:59
标签:
本文全面剖析电子表格软件计算出现偏差的十八种常见原因,结合微软官方文档和真实案例,深入讲解浮点数精度、数据类型转换、公式误用等核心问题。通过具体场景演示偏差产生机制,并提供实用解决策略,帮助用户提升数据处理的准确性和专业性。
为什么excel算数会有偏差

       在日常使用电子表格软件进行数据计算时,许多用户都曾遭遇计算结果与预期不符的困扰。这种偏差可能源于软件底层设计、操作习惯或环境因素,若不深入理解,极易导致数据分析失误。本文基于微软官方技术文档和常见问题库,系统梳理计算偏差的成因,并辅以典型案例,旨在为用户提供一套完整的防错指南。

一、浮点数精度限制导致的计算误差

       电子表格软件采用二进制浮点数表示数值,而人类习惯的十进制数字在转换过程中可能产生无限循环小数,导致精度损失。例如,计算零点一加零点二时,软件可能返回零点三零零零零零零零零零零零零零四而非精确的零点三。这种偏差在累计计算中会放大,如财务汇总时出现分位误差。参考微软支持文档中关于浮点运算的说明,建议用户使用舍入函数控制显示位数。

       案例一:某企业工资表计算个税时,因累进税率涉及小数相乘,最终实发金额与手工核算差零点零一元。案例二:科研数据拟合中,零点一乘以十次方结果与理论值偏差千分之一,影响实验。

二、数据类型自动转换引发数值失真

       软件会自动将输入内容识别为数字、文本或日期等类型,若用户未明确格式,可能导致计算错误。例如,以文本形式存储的数字参与求和时会被忽略,而带符号的金额字符串可能被误判为公式。微软官方建议使用“分列”功能统一数据类型,或通过函数强制转换。

       案例一:导入供应商编号时,首位零被自动删除,导致编码错误。案例二:汇率数据带百分号,直接相乘后结果放大百倍。

三、公式运算符优先级误解造成逻辑混乱

       加减乘除与乘方混合运算时,用户常忽略默认的优先级规则。例如,计算一加二乘以三,若未加括号,软件会先执行乘法得到七,而非用户预期的九。根据微软公式规范,乘除优先于加减,复杂表达式需显式使用括号分组。

       案例一:学生计算平均分时,总分除以科目数未括起来,导致分母错误。案例二:工程报价中折扣计算顺序颠倒,最终金额偏差百分之二十。

四、相对引用与绝对引用混淆导致区域计算错误

       复制公式时,单元格引用方式决定数据源是否随位置变化。相对引用在拖动填充时自动偏移,而绝对引用锁定固定位置。若混合使用不当,如汇总表引用动态范围,会造成部分数据遗漏或重复。微软指南强调通过美元符号固定行号列标。

       案例一:月度报表中同比公式未锁定基期年份,下拉后所有月份均与最新数据对比。案例二:多表关联时,链接地址随插入行变动,引发参考丢失。

五、数字格式显示与实际存储值不符

       单元格格式仅控制视觉效果,实际计算仍按存储值进行。例如,设置小数位数为零时,零点六显示为一,但求和时仍按零点六累计。此类问题在审计对账中尤为突出,微软建议通过公式栏核对真实数值。

       案例一:库存数量取整显示,实际盘点与系统总量差三点五单位。案例二:百分比格式下,零点一五显示为百分之十五,但乘以一百后得十五而非十五点零。

六、手动计算模式下的更新滞后

       软件默认为自动计算,但大型文件可能设为手动模式以提升性能。此时修改数据后未刷新,结果仍为旧值。根据微软设置说明,可通过状态栏检查计算状态,或使用快捷键强制重算。

       案例一:财务模型修改假设参数后,关键指标未实时更新,导致决策失误。案例二:协作编辑时,不同用户版本计算进度不一,汇总数据矛盾。

七、日期和时间序列号转换偏差

       软件将日期存储为整数序列(以一九零零年一月一日为基准),时间则为小数部分。跨系统导出或格式转换时,时区差异或闰年规则可能引发错误。微软文档指出一九零零年闰年bug仍影响旧版本,需用函数校正。

       案例一:计算员工工龄时,入职日期格式混乱,结果多算一天。案例二:跨时区会议时长计算,未统一时间基准导致重叠时段丢失。

八、数组公式的特殊运算规则

       数组公式可批量处理数据区域,但需按特定组合键确认。若误用普通回车,仅返回首元素结果。此外,动态数组功能在新旧版本中行为不同,可能破坏原有逻辑。参考微软更新日志,建议测试兼容性后再部署。

       案例一:多条件筛选未用数组公式,返回单一值而非完整列表。案例二:升级后原数组区域自动溢出,覆盖相邻数据。

九、外部数据链接失效或不同步

       引用其他文件或数据库时,路径变更、权限限制或网络延迟会导致数据缺失。微软最佳实践提示应定期验证链接状态,并避免使用绝对路径。

       案例一:季度报告链接的销售数据文件被移动,所有公式返回错误值。案例二:实时汇率接口超时,外汇计算使用缓存旧值。

十、宏或脚本执行中的逻辑缺陷

       自定义宏可能包含循环错误或变量未初始化等问题,例如累加器未复位导致合计翻倍。微软开发者文档强调需进行边界测试,并避免硬编码数值。

       案例一:批量舍入宏误用取整函数,小数点后全部归零。案例二:数据清洗脚本遗漏空值处理,统计计数偏少。

十一、版本差异引起的函数行为变化

       不同版本软件对函数的处理规则可能调整,如旧版四舍五入函数在新版中采用银行家舍入法。微软兼容性列表指出,部分统计函数算法已优化,但结果略有差异。

       案例一:二零一零版本计算的方差与二零一九版本差零点零零一。案例二:文本合并函数在跨平台打开时分隔符丢失。

十二、系统资源不足导致计算中断

       处理海量数据时,内存或CPU限制会使公式部分执行,结果不完整。微软性能指南推荐拆分大型模型,或启用多线程计算选项。

       案例一:百万行数据排序时崩溃,恢复后部分公式值为井号溢出。案例二:复杂模拟运算未完成,输出区域留空。

十三、舍入误差在迭代计算中累积

       循环引用或迭代求解时,每次舍入会放大误差,如计算复利时最终本金偏差显著。微软建议设置迭代次数上限,并监控收敛条件。

       案例一:求解方程根时,迭代十次后结果震荡不收敛。案例二:预算分配算法因舍入导致总额超支百分之一。

十四、统计函数内置算法的局限性

       标准差、相关系数等函数可能采用近似算法,尤其对偏态分布数据敏感。微软技术文章指出,样本方差计算分母用n减一而非n,易引发误解。

       案例一:抽样调查中,软件返回的标准误与理论公式结果差百分之五。案例二:极端值导致相关系数计算溢出,返回错误代码。

十五、条件格式或数据验证干扰计算流程

       视觉提示或输入限制虽不直接影响公式,但可能掩盖数据异常。例如条件格式标记错误值后,用户误以为已修正。微软提醒应优先处理公式错误而非格式修饰。

       案例一:负利润被格式化为红色,但实际计算仍包含无效数据。案例二:数据验证拒绝小数输入,导致百分比计算基数错误。

十六、保护工作表或单元格锁定限制编辑

       受保护区域无法修改公式或数据,若未解除保护直接计算,结果可能基于过时值。微软安全指南说明需授权后再进行批量操作。

       案例一:共享预算表部分单元格锁定,协作成员无法修正引用错误。案例二:模板文件保护状态下,宏更新失败。

十七、区域设置与数字格式冲突

       不同地区小数点、千分位符号不同(如点与逗号),文件跨系统打开时解析错误。微软国际化文档建议统一使用系统区域设置或显式指定格式。

       案例一:欧洲用户发送的csv文件在中文系统内逗号被识别为分隔符,数值断裂。案例二:汇率计算中货币符号被误读为文本。

十八、用户操作习惯引入的随机误差

       匆忙中输入多余空格、误拖填充柄或误删公式,均会造成偏差。微软培训材料强调养成核对习惯,如启用公式审核工具。

       案例一:粘贴数据时保留源格式,数字转为文本类型。案例二:筛选状态下求和,结果仅包含可见单元格而非全量。

       综上所述,电子表格计算偏差是多因素交织的结果,需从数据源头、公式设计到系统环境全面把控。通过理解上述原理并实践案例中的解决方案,用户可显著提升计算可靠性,让数据真正服务于决策。

本文系统阐述电子表格软件计算偏差的十八类成因,涵盖精度限制、引用错误、版本兼容等关键环节。通过结合官方文档与实战案例,不仅揭示问题本质,更提供具体改进方法,助力用户实现精准高效的数据处理。
相关文章
word分级是什么意思
文档分级是文字处理软件中用于构建文档层次体系的核心功能,它通过设定不同级别的标题来实现内容的逻辑化组织。本文将深入解析分级的概念起源、操作流程、实际应用案例及常见问题解决方案,帮助用户掌握这一提升文档编辑效率的实用技能。
2025-09-26 13:34:36
129人看过
什么软件可以扫描生成word
本文深入解析了能够将扫描文档转换为可编辑Word格式的多款软件工具,涵盖了专业OCR应用程序、在线服务平台以及移动端应用等类型。通过详细介绍每款软件的核心功能、操作步骤及实际应用案例,如合同数字化、书籍转换等场景,帮助用户根据自身需求选择最合适的解决方案。内容基于官方权威资料,确保信息准确可靠,旨在提供实用性强、专业度高的指南。
2025-09-26 13:34:32
303人看过
word为什么保存不了pdf
许多用户在尝试将Word文档保存为PDF格式时遇到困难,这一问题可能源于软件设置、系统兼容性或操作失误等多重因素。本文将系统分析十八个常见原因,结合官方资料和实际案例,帮助读者彻底排查并解决保存失败问题。
2025-09-26 13:33:47
88人看过
通知word格式是什么
本文全面探讨通知文档在Word中的格式设置方法,从基础概念到高级技巧逐一解析。通过分解页面布局、字体选择、段落调整等关键环节,结合企业通知和学校公告等实际案例,提供 step-by-step 操作指南。帮助用户快速掌握专业文档制作要领,提升办公效率与文档美观度。
2025-09-26 13:33:42
180人看过
word什么时候有查找
本文深度剖析微软Word中查找功能的发展史与实用指南。基于官方文档,文章系统回顾查找命令从Word 1.0首次引入到最新版本的演变过程,涵盖15个核心论点,包括版本特性、操作技巧及常见问题解决方案。每个论点辅以真实案例,帮助用户掌握查找功能的最佳使用时机,提升文档处理效率。
2025-09-26 13:33:40
391人看过
word智能指针是什么
智能指针是编程语言中用于自动化管理内存资源的重要工具,尤其在C++中扮演着关键角色。本文将从基本概念入手,系统介绍智能指针的定义、类型、工作原理及实际应用,通过具体案例解析唯一指针、共享指针等核心类型的使用方法,并探讨常见问题与最佳实践,帮助开发者提升代码安全性和效率。
2025-09-26 13:33:35
123人看过